eStragand - October 26, 2006 03:51 PM (GMT)
I suppose I should get that '84 Wolvie mini-series one of these days. Assuming they're not CGC, I'd be interested in those. Realistically, the set SELLS for about 20 bucks on eBay. People LIST it for 50-80, but not too many move at that price.
The Hulk 181, Giant-Size 1 and early X-men books (I'm guessing #94-100) should land you some good cash. If they're in F condition or better, then you should seriously list them on eBay. Pictures, detailed description, etc. Don't half-ass your listing and you'll get a fair price. Especially GS #1, Hulk #181 and X-men #94. Stuff from #95 to about #110 will not land hefty sums, but they're usually in demand.
The Sabretooth, Gambit, Cable and Bishop issues aren't in high demand. The Sabretooth/Iron Fist is pricey simply because it's rare. Have to ask-- that'd be Dardevil's "Bullseye" you're talking about? Cuz' sometimes you'll see an old Strange Tales incorrectly proclaiming to be the "first Bullseye" (different character, same name). The Gambit, Bishop and Cable issues...honestly, don't expect alot for those.
Remember, there's no such thing as "how much is this comic worth?" The old slogan is "it's only worth as much as someone wants to pay for it". If you're looking through Wizard's laughable "price guide", do NOT expect to receive those prices. Overstreet and eBay are the best references.
